Notes
A shore dive near a local landmark known as "Curiosity Rocks" — a massive pile of granite boulders believed to be remnants of a glacier from the last Ice Age. Beneath the surface, submerged trees appear among the rocks, which are draped in abandoned anchor ropes. These are left behind by boaters whose anchors became wedged between the boulders and could not be retrieved. The topography is fascinating, and this is possibly my favourite dive in Jindabyne.
